Mar 7, 2023 at 4:09 PM Post #1,768 of 4,163
I think most software only MQA unfolds are just the one (UAPP & Tidal app are). Its the Walkman software that does it, not a dedicated chip like in say the Hiby R5GII which is 8 times, but honestly I can't hear the difference of more than one unfold.
Tidal app - or for example Audirvana (Win, MacOS), UAPP (android) - does the core (call it software) unfold (1st level) - resulting in a max 44.1 / 48KHz stream and that's what you get/hear depending on the source recording. Some DAC's render/unfold to 4. 8 or 16X. I have an ifi Zen Air desktop DAC - configured as MQA renderer (which in fact it is) on Audirvana - which informs on screen the bit depth / rate which the ifi DAC is reproducing - and always matches what is coming from Tidal - tested several Tidal Master tracks from 48 / 96 / 192 up to 352.8KHz. A full MQA decoder device (Fiio Q3 / Hiby R3 pro etc) also have the 1st level (core) implemented, so you can configure "MQA passthrough" in Tidal (releasing CPU load) or directly decode mqa.flac files from your storage library.
